{"data":{"id":"us/43-cfr-45.30","jurisdiction":"us","citation":"43 CFR 45.30","heading":"What will the Hearings Division do with a case referral?","body":"Within 5 days after the effective date stated in the referral notice under § 45.26(c)(4), 7 CFR 1.626(c)(4), or 50 CFR 221.26(c)(4):\n(a) The Hearings Division must:\n(1) Docket the case;\n(2) Assign an ALJ to preside over the hearing process and issue a decision; and\n(3) Issue a docketing notice that informs the parties of the docket number and the ALJ assigned to the case; and\n(b) The ALJ must issue a notice setting the time, place, and method for conducting an initial prehearing conference under § 45.40. This notice may be combined with the docketing notice under paragraph (a)(3) of this section.","path":["Title 43—Public Lands: Interior","Subtitle A—Office of the Secretary of the Interior","PART 45—CONDITIONS AND PRESCRIPTIONS IN FERC HYDROPOWER LICENSES","Subpart B—Hearing Process"],"source_url":"https://www.ecfr.gov/api/versioner/v1/full/2026-08-25/title-43.xml","current_through":"2026-08-25","vintage":"","retrieved_at":"2026-08-27T02:26:15Z","sha256":"de65ca663d1bbfadfea60b63da430a92fff43a67bd3ecb78764ba89b598a870f","source_id":"us-cfr","stale":true,"prev":"us/43-cfr-45.27","next":"us/43-cfr-45.31"},"notice":"GroundRules: Original legal text.
